    The first thing Wei Ying became aware of was cold steel at his throat.
    Not one blade—several.
    He did not move.

    Sleep still clung to him, heavy and disorienting, but instinct burned through it fast enough. His eyes cracked open to darkness cut by lantern light, and beyond it, the rigid silhouettes of Gusu Lan disciples. White robes. Swords steady. Not trembling.
    Not a mistake, then.

    Wei Ying let out a slow breath, careful not to shift against the edge pressing lightly into his skin. “Well,” he said, voice rough with sleep, “this is a new way to wake up.”

    No one laughed.
    That, more than the swords, told him something was very wrong.

    “You will come with us,” one disciple said. Young. Formal. Afraid—but hiding it well. “You are to be detained and questioned.”

    “Questioned?” Wei Ying echoed. His mind raced, sifting through the previous day. Punishments—yes. Lan Wangji standing over him like a silent judge. Copying rules until his wrist ached. Kneeling until his legs went numb. Nothing new, nothing unusual, nothing that should end with… this.

    He frowned. “Did I break a new rule I haven’t heard of yet?”
